Is the 2018 LEXUS IS300 reliable?

Excellent reliability. Very few MOT failures. That's 18 points above the national average of 82%. It also outperforms the LEXUS brand average of 87%.

At 6 years old, 100% of LEXUS IS300s from 2018 passed their MOT first time in 2024. That's based on 31 tests across the UK. The average mileage at this age is 33,082 miles.

Mileage Analysis

The average 2018 LEXUS IS300 has 33,082 miles on the clock, which is below the expected 44,400 miles for a 6-year-old car. This suggests lighter use than average, which generally means less wear on major components.

2018 LEXUS IS300 Fuel Costs

The 2497cc hybrid engine offers a reasonable balance between performance and economy. Expect around 30 mpg in mixed driving, which works out to roughly £1,592 per year at current hybrid prices of 142p per litre (based on 7,400 miles per year). As a hybrid, real-world fuel costs will vary significantly depending on how much electric-only driving you do.

What does it cost to own a 2018 LEXUS IS300?

Total estimated annual running cost is £2,037 170/month), broken down as £1592 fuel, £190 road tax, £55 MOT, and £200 predicted repairs. The low repair estimate reflects the excellent 100% pass rate. These cars rarely fail their MOT, so unexpected bills are less likely.

Buying a Used 2018 LEXUS IS300

At 6 years old, the LEXUS IS300 offers good value with plenty of life remaining. Most manufacturer warranties will have expired, so a pre-purchase inspection is worth the cost. If you're flexible on year, the 2016 model has the highest pass rate at 98%. Note: with only 31 tests in our data, these figures should be treated as indicative rather than definitive.
